Kent Dean Klingman, Volga, Iowa, October 27, 2025

Kent Dean Klingman, 61, of Volga, passed away Monday, October 27, 2025, at Mercy One in Waterloo. He was born August 2, 1964, in Vinton, to Lyle and Karon (Buhr) Klingman.

Kent attended Central Community School, graduating with the Class of 1983. During high school, he worked for Jim and Marilyn Miller at Spring Valley Ranch just outside of Volga. Following graduation, he joined the U.S. Army, serving in Germany as an M.P.  Upon discharge, he went on to Hawkeye Tech in Waterloo, where he graduated with a truck driver degree. Kent worked for various trucking companies during his career; he loved crossing the states on the open road. He worked until January of 2018, when he retired from driving.

On August 19, 2006, he married Jennifer Richmond of Strawberry Point, Iowa.  The couple later divorced.

He was a member of St. Paul Lutheran Church in Volga.

Kent had several hobbies, including fishing and hunting–and processing the meat himself, watching sci-fi, western and action movies, playing video games, and making custom fishing poles.

Survivors include his son, Chad Hannan of Volga; sister, Rhonda (Craig) Fry of Volga; aunts and uncles, Charles and Norma Graybill, Gary and Nancy Klingman, John Buhr, Marlene and Michael Grimm, and Doreen and Daryl Forbes.

He was preceded in death by his parents, Lyle and Karon; aunts  Linda McClusky and Mary Buhr and uncle, Dennis Klingman.
